GoSS minister of Agriculture and Forestry said the government is stepping up measures to deal with people who misuse the forests in the region for their own profit using fake permits.

Anne Itto said there are people who used forged documents in order to cut down trees in various states.

She added that she met with the governor of Western Equatoria State and agreed to put in place a mechanism that will check the authenticity of documents provided by loggers.

Dr. Itto said the meeting also resolved communication issues which will help to single out people who want to make illegal money through forestry in South Sudan.

Dr. Itto made this announcement on Friday at Juba Airport upon her arrival from Yambio where she studied ways of raising food production in South Sudan.
